Students go on a GPS scavenger hunt. They use GPS receivers to find designated waypoints and report back on what they found. They compute distances between waypoints based on the latitude and longitude, and compare with the distance the receiver finds.
GPS has applications on land, at sea and in the air. Engineer-designed GPS navigation systems are used at sea by recreational boaters, commercial fisherman, cruise lines and shippers. In land-based vehicles, GPS systems show the vehicle's position on a street map so drivers can keep track of where they are, suggest the best route to reach a certain location, and aid in obtaining emergency roadside assistance by transmitting the vehicle's current position to a dispatch center. In the skies, GPS is used by all types of aircraft.
After this activity, students should be able to:
- Use numbers to count, measure, label, and indicate distances on a GPS receiver,
- Measure and calculate values from acquired data,
- Understand the connections between GPS technology and navigation, aircraft, and many forms of transportation
